That stated, there are a handful of specific times that truly would dictate putting in the time to examine and update not simply your Will, but all of your Estate Preparation documents. These significant life events might include: Marital changes: Marital status is among the most apparent and typical reasons for modifying a Will. You ought to know if you live in a neighborhood home or common law state as well. New additions: Any brand-new additions to the household, such as the births of children or grandchildren, would call for an update to your Will. One note to keep in mind, unlike biological children, stepchildren do not inherit immediately. It's normal to feel a little anxiety about the prospect of having to alter your Will.
